[Comm] [JT] Создание загрузочного раздела с дистрибутивом

Владимир Гусев =?iso-8859-1?q?vova1971_=CE=C1_narod=2Eru?=
Пн Июн 9 20:19:49 MSD 2008


On Mon, 9 Jun 2008 18:42:12 +0400
Michael A. Kangin wrote:

> В сообщении от Monday 09 June 2008 18:17:46 Владимир Гусев написал(а):
> > > > > > Хм. fdisk-ом прописывается старая разбивка диска, и потом
> > > > > > _НИЧЕГО НЕ ПЕРЕРАЗМЕЧАЯ_ можно совершенно спокойно дальше
> > > > > > использовать "безвозвратно утерянную" информацию.
> > > > >
> > > > > Это хорошо, если эта разбивка известна. Я, например, на всякий
> > > > > случай делаю копию `fdisk -l` на бумажке.
> > > >
> > > > В треде это я приводил:
> > > >
> > > > Было так:
> > > >
> > > > Disk /dev/sda: 40.0 GB, 40007761920 bytes
> > > > 64 heads, 32 sectors/track, 38154 cylinders
> > > > Units = cylinders of 2048 * 512 = 1048576 bytes
> > > > Disk identifier: 0x6c66cbc3
> > > >
> > > >    Device Boot      Start         End      Blocks   Id  System
> > > > /dev/sda1   *           1       38154    39069680    c  W95
> > > > FAT32 (LBA)
> > > >
> > > > Сейчас после прописывания заново так:
> > > >
> > > > Disk /dev/sda: 40.0 GB, 40007761920 bytes
> > > > 64 heads, 32 sectors/track, 38154 cylinders
> > > > Units = cylinders of 2048 * 512 = 1048576 bytes
> > > > Disk identifier: 0x00000000
> > > >
> > > >    Device Boot      Start         End      Blocks   Id  System
> > > > /dev/sda1   *           1       38154    39069680    c  W95
> > > > FAT32 (LBA)
> > > >
> > > > вроде все то же самое... Disk identifier - это по-моему метка,
> > > > название, ее тоже нужно восстановить. Вспоминаю как..
> > >
> > > Нет, видио это совсем не то... При fdisk -l у меня нет ругани типа
> > > doesn't contain a valid partition table. Раздел-то я создал такой
> > > же заново.. Раздел не монтируется - ни автоматом, ни вручную..
> > >
> > > [root на book ~]# mount /dev/sda1 /mnt/install
> > > mount: you must specify the filesystem type
> > > [root на book ~]# mount -t vfat /dev/sda1 /mnt/install
> > > mount: wrong fs type, bad option, bad superblock on /dev/sda1,
> > >        missing codepage or helper program, or other error
> > >        In some cases useful info is found in syslog - try
> > >        dmesg | tail  or so
> > >
> > > Смотрел в сети про Disk identifier: 0x00000000 - там только он
> > > упоминается в выводах команды fdisk -l.. Сам по себе винт живой,
> > > запускается при подключении по usb.
> >
> 
> > После восстановления label путем  mkfs.vfat -n Backup /dev/sda1
> > раздел стал монтироваться вручную и автоматически.. но там пусто....
> > полностью. До этого я запускал testdisk и пытался восстановить boot
> > sector, как понял из вывода после операции - безрезультатно.. Но
> > как? Данные ведь там.. я не форматировал ничего...
> 
> mkfs.vfat -n Backup /dev/sda1 не восстанавливает label, а делает на
> разделе новую файловую систему (aka форматирует его) и присваивает
> свежей ФС метку Backup.

Опа... а -n разве не просто присваивает этот label? Это же операция, не
предусматривающая никакого aka форматирования... 

-- 
С уважением,
Владимир Гусев



Подробная информация о списке рассылки community